Flagwright reads all configuration from the environment at boot. Set FLAGWRIGHT_ENV to staging or prod, FLAGWRIGHT_COHORT_SIZE to an integer percentage, and FLAGWRIGHT_SYNC_INTERVAL in seconds. Rollout state is persisted to the Ledgewick store; the client refuses to start without credentials for it. Review the defaults in config/defaults.toml before approving changes—overrides here win silently. The store credential goes in the env file directly below this paragraph.

vault entry, yahif-yajep: COURIER_KEY29=b802bdf8034096b65a51c6ba5abe2

**Q: My export failed. Can I retry it?**

Yes. Failed exports in the Corveld plugin framework can be retried up to three times within 24 hours. Use the retry hook rather than re-submitting the job, since re-submission creates a duplicate manifest and will be rejected. Exponential backoff is applied automatically between attempts. Full retry semantics and error codes are documented on this page:

runbook for kawef-hahif: https://jira.lumicsys.internal/projects/browse/display/c08d703c

## Runbook: Connection Pool Changes

Plugin authors integrating with the Ostermill data layer: release 7.1 caps per-plugin pool size at twelve connections and enforces a two-second acquisition timeout. Audit your plugins for long-held connections and release them promptly, or requests will queue and time out. After updating, run the pool stress check in the sandbox. Signed plugin packages only — sign your archive with the key below.

release key, fafof-hawip: bky6_52YEwQ

**Mgmt Meeting Minutes — Retiring the Brightline Range**

Quick recap for sales leads at Fenholt Supplies: we agreed to retire the Brightline fixture range by year-end. Remaining stock moves to clearance pricing next month, and accounts on standing orders get migrated to the Lumetta range. Trade-in incentives were approved in principle. The confidential note on next steps sits just below.

board note of bajof-bajeg: The pricing group signed off on a budget of $13.4 million for Project Sildor. The renewal with Lamixek Holdings closes at $48.9 million a year, 49 percent above the last contract.